Hi,

We installed Infosphere using the default oracle port of 1521 for our repository database. Now we need to change it. I have scoured the internet and can not find any instructions on how to do so. Does anyone have instructions on how to get this done?

We simply tried changing the client tnsnames.ora file after updating the db server with the new port, but it didn't work. There are many many references to 1521 in various files throughout the installation. Do I need to re-install???

I got a good answer from IBM. These changes worked: 1. stop websphere 2. update the port number in \IBM\InformationServer\ASBServer\apps\lib\ojb-conf.jar/repository_database.xml 3. update the port in \IBM\InformationServer\ASBServer\bin\sql\database.properties 4. start websphere 5. update all database ports under JDBC Providers in the WebSphere Application Server administrative console
